Output 3d11ea2e2772986d38110c1fa40efcd706a29bf73fb15c7e5edd0dcc8957b7f2:1

value
106276800
script pubkey
OP_0 OP_PUSHBYTES_20 18f3fe76a0e2406ca62253cc5001b60d94149101
address
bc1qrrelua4qufqxef3z20x9qqdkpk2pfygpa4rvct
transaction
3d11ea2e2772986d38110c1fa40efcd706a29bf73fb15c7e5edd0dcc8957b7f2
confirmations
171090
spent
true